Rejected at Burma / Thai border

Featured Replies

Did the visa run from Chiang Mai to Burma today. I was told that I'm a border runner . And was not allowed to leave the country, because I used one border pass before. Last month my third visa stamp was rejected because they said it was one month over. So I got a one-month stamp and then I tried to do it again and they told me know now I'm stuck . Need a one-month stamp because month I have all my money wrapped up in going to Laos next month to get the two stamps . For the trip next month Already paid for the for the plane ticket ,the hotel room everything is nonrefundable. I'm screwed I need help really bad.

If you have a visa exempt entry, you can extend that by 30 days for 1,900 baht at an immigration office. if you already did that, you have no other option than to leave the country as no extension is available.

You could fly out of Bangkok and return on a new visa exempt entry.

  • Author

Same day ?

Same day. But safer to wait a few days and even more safe to get a double entry tourist visa in Laos.

They can question you at the airport and then you have to convince them that you are not working illegally. Showing proof of funds coming from abroad will help.
